Police observe “Meri Maati Mera Desh” campaign in various police establishments
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

Srinagar: As a part of “Azadi Ka Amrit Mahotsav”, Police observed “Meri Maati Mera Desh” a nationwide campaign, which commenced today, at various Police establishments across the Kashmir valley. Besides, police led plantation drives & Tiranga rallies as part of the campaign at various district establishments. 

The campaign “Meri Maati Mera Desh”, which aims to foster a deep sense of national pride, was conducted under the esteemed guidance of District and Zonal heads in their respective jurisdictional areas. Participation of police officers, officials, school contingents, and esteemed citizens, each taking a solemn oath to shape a brighter future for India was witnessed during the campaign.

In Baramulla, various events were held with the main event held at District Police Lines Baramulla where DIG NKR Vivek Gupta-IPS administers a pledge to officers/Jawans of DPL Baramulla & school contingents. SSP Baramulla Amod Ashok Nagapure-IPS, SP Hqrs Baramulla Divya D-IPS, DySP DAR DPL Baramulla, DySP JIC Baramulla, In-charge PCR Baramulla & other officers of Police/CAPF were also present. Likewise, all SDPOs/SHOs & In-charge PPs also administered pledges to the officers/officials at all Sub Divisions, Police Stations & Police Posts.

In Shopian, under this campaign, plantation drives were held across the district with the main drive held at DPL Shopian where SSP Shopian Tanushree-IPS planted local plants and other ornamental plants at DPL Shopian. ASP Shopian Naresh Singh, DySP Hqrs Shopian, DySP DAR DPL Shopian, DySP PC Keller & other officers of Police/ CAPF were present. Besides, all SDPOs/ SHOs & IC PPs also held the plantation drives in their respective jurisdictions at all Sub Divisions/ Police Stations & police posts.

In Bandipora, Tiranga rallies & pledge ceremonies were organized at all police establishments of the district in collaboration with various educational institutions and civil societies. SSP Bandipora Lakshay Sharma-IPS led the Tiranga rally from District Police Lines Bandipora to DPO Bandipora. ASP Bandipora Sandeep Bhat-JKPS, DySP Hqrs, DySP DAR Bandipora, and other officers & jawans of district police Bandipora were part of the rally. Later, SSP Bandipora administered a pledge to all participants at DPO Bandipora.

In Pulwama, veers of the nation who made supreme sacrifices for the country were venerated, revered, and commemorated for their enormous contribution to the freedom, cohesion, and integrity of the nation. The event included inauguration of Silaphalakam, a youth rally, and felicitation of families of martyrs. Remarkable participation of people coupled with enthusiasm was witnessed at all the locations. SSP Pulwama, ASP Pulwama, DySP Hqrs Pulwama, DySP DAR Pulwama, and other officers were present.

In Budgam, a pledge for the country’s progress was held in all the police establishments of the district. SSP Budgam administered the pledge to police officers & officers of district Budgam at DPO Budgam. One of the highlights of the campaign’s launch was the participation of police officers and personnel in uploading their selfies on the official government portal. Besides, striking banners and posters were placed strategically at prominent locations throughout the district.

In Ganderbal, Handwara, Awantipora & Sopore, different events were organized including installing banners and posters at prominent locations & held the Tiranga rallies.
